An analysis suggests that the movement of 10,000 Bitcoins (BTC) that had not moved for 14 years could signal upcoming volatility.
On the 4th (local time), CryptoQuant author Mignolet reported, "10,000 BTC moved from a dormant address for the first time in 14 years, and this transfer is the largest among the amounts held for over 10 years since the cycle low in November 2022."
He added, "Most market participants tend to interpret such data simply as a sell signal. Although it’s unclear exactly where the transferred funds are heading, this rare movement of old coins has been observed and could signal significant volatility in the market."
